    This is one of my favorite Star Wars polybags yet.

    Box/Instructions:

    Comes in a polybag with a normal polybag sized instructions.

    Parts:

    The yellow pieces are nice to get as they aren't overly common to get. Other than that there aren't any cool and unique pieces in this set. The total piece count is 48.

    The Build:

    The build is quick and easy. There is nothing hard or difficult with it. It took me a couple of minutes to build.

    Overall Opinion:

    Overall this is a great Star Wars polybag. This is definitely one of my favorite ones yet. I own one of the larger scale Naboo N-1 Starfighters (set 7877) and it is a very good replica of it. It is very solid and sturdy. You can hold the tail on the back of the starfighter and spin it, which is nice. Overall I am giving this a 5-star rating.

    I have not yet been fortunate to pick up a full sized LEGO Star Wars Naboo Starfighter set yet, so when I saw a well scaled, cheap polybag version, I knew that I just had to pick it up.

    While it would have been nice to get chrome elements instead of light gray, I know that LEGO would never do that for a retail set like this, so I will let that pass. The build it self is sleek and well scaled to the real thing. The representation of an astromech is nice and a lot better than the 1x1 studs that are often used. The build it sturdy and doesn't have any specific weak spots. A fun thing that I like to do is grab the pole in the back and spin it around like in the movie. There are no especially rare pieces included

    Overall, this is just a fun little set that kids would like and can be used in a microscale space battle fro adults. Even as a teen, I enjoyed playing with this set and I encourage you to pick it up if you happen to find it at your local store.

    Set #30383 Naboo Starfighter: The Phantom Menace Starfighter comes to life once again in this LEGO Polybag model and it is a very solid model for the price. As with most Polybag Reviews let’s discuss the pros and cons before moving on to overall thoughts.

    Pros:

    • Good parts-per-piece value.
    • Excellent model for fans of the Naboo Starfighter design.
    • Great playable model.

    Cons:

    • Difficult to find at retail as with most Polybags.
    • Quick to sell out.

    Overall opinion

    I find myself really enjoying this set. The model was great fun to build and it’s awesome to play with or display. The cons are pretty minor and rather nitpicky honestly, the only thing I’d say is a real drawback is the lack of retail presence. I’m also starting to wish that LEGO would include small action flight stands as part of these sets so the ships can be displayed mid-flight instead of parked in the hangar. Overall though, as with most Star Wars Polybags I’d strongly recommend getting this one if you’re a fan of this ship design.
